Deep Small Intestine Endoscopy: A Guide for Small Bowel Tumor Treatment
Introduction and Terminology of the Procedure
Deep Small Intestine Endoscopy, also known as enteroscopy, is a crucial medical procedure for the diagnosis and treatment of small bowel tumors. This endoscopic procedure allows your healthcare professional to examine your small intestine in-depth. The small intestine, which includes three parts: the duodenum, jejunum, and ileum, is typically hard to access, making this procedure particularly specialized.

Indications for Deep Small Intestine Endoscopy
A deep small intestine endoscopy is generally indicated for the following reasons:
- Diagnosis: The procedure helps identify small bowel tumors that may not be visible with other imaging studies. Early detection can lead to more effective treatment plans.
- Treatment: During the procedure, the healthcare professional can perform interventions such as polyp removal, biopsy, or tumor ablation, making it a valuable therapeutic tool.
- Bleeding: Unexplained gastrointestinal bleeding that can’t be sourced from the stomach or colon might have its origin in the small intestine.
- Iron Deficiency Anemia: This condition, which often accompanies unexplained intestinal bleeding, may warrant a deep small intestine endoscopy for diagnosis.

Pre-Op Preparation
Preparing for a deep small intestine endoscopy involves several crucial steps:
- Fasting: Typically, patients are asked to fast (no food or drink) for several hours before the procedure.
- Medications: Some medications may need to be adjusted or stopped prior to the procedure. Your healthcare provider will give you specific instructions.
- Pre-Op Labs or Imaging: Additional testing may be necessary to ensure the procedure’s safety and effectiveness.
- Pre-Clearance Authorization: Your insurance may require pre-approval for this procedure.
- Transportation and Work or School Notes: As you’ll be sedated, you’ll need to arrange transportation home and may need to take the rest of the day off work or school.

Procedure Technique for Deep Small Intestine Endoscopy
Understanding the step-by-step process of a Deep Small Intestine Endoscopy can help alleviate some of the anxiety you may be feeling about your upcoming procedure. The following is a simplified walkthrough of the process. Remember, while this guide can provide you with a general idea of what to expect, your healthcare provider will be able to offer more personalized information.
Step 1: Pre-procedure preparations
On the day of the procedure, you’ll arrive at the medical facility, and the healthcare team will prepare you for the endoscopy. This preparation typically involves changing into a hospital gown and an initial check of your vital signs. An intravenous (IV) line may also be placed in your arm to administer sedatives during the procedure.
Step 2: Sedation
You’ll likely be given a sedative medication to help you relax. This sedative is typically administered through the IV line. It’s important to note that you will be awake but relaxed and won’t feel any pain.
Step 3: Positioning
Once the sedative has taken effect, you’ll be positioned on your side. This allows the doctor to have the best possible access to your mouth and throat, which is where the endoscope will be inserted.
Step 4: Insertion of the endoscope
The doctor will insert a long, flexible tube called an endoscope through your mouth and down your throat. The endoscope has a light and a camera on the end, allowing the doctor to see and capture images of your small intestine.
Step 5: Advancing the endoscope
The doctor will carefully advance the endoscope through your esophagus, stomach, and into your small intestine. This is a delicate process, as the doctor must ensure the endoscope doesn’t cause any harm to your digestive tract.
Step 6: Examination
Once the endoscope has reached the small intestine, the doctor will closely examine the lining of your intestine. They’ll be looking for any signs of tumors or other abnormalities. The images from the endoscope are displayed on a monitor for detailed viewing.
Step 7: Intervention (if needed)
If the doctor identifies any tumors or other abnormalities, they may decide to intervene immediately. This could involve taking tissue samples (biopsy) or removing polyps or tumors if they’re small enough. The doctor can also mark areas for further investigation or treatment.
Step 8: Removal of the endoscope
Once the examination and any necessary interventions are complete, the doctor will carefully withdraw the endoscope. This process is generally quicker than the insertion and examination stages.
Step 9: Post-procedure recovery
After the endoscope is removed, you’ll be taken to a recovery area. The sedative effects will wear off over time. Due to the lingering effects of the sedative, you’ll need someone to drive you home after the procedure.

Duration of Deep Small Intestine Endoscopy
The duration of a Deep Small Intestine Endoscopy generally ranges from 30 minutes to an hour, depending on the complexity of the procedure and whether any therapeutic interventions, such as biopsy or tumor removal, are necessary.
Post-Op Recovery from Deep Small Intestine Endoscopy
Post-operative recovery after a Deep Small Intestine Endoscopy typically involves a brief observation period in the recovery area until the sedation wears off. This usually takes one to two hours. Most patients are discharged the same day, but you will need someone to drive you home due to the lingering effects of the sedative.
Follow-up appointments will be scheduled with your doctor to discuss the results of the procedure and any necessary next steps. You might feel minor discomfort or bloating due to the introduced air, but this usually resolves within a day. It’s generally recommended to rest for the remainder of the day following the procedure.
Most patients can resume regular activities within a day or two, but this can vary based on individual circumstances. Effectiveness of Deep Small Intestine Endoscopy
Deep Small Intestine Endoscopy has proven highly effective in the diagnosis and treatment of small bowel tumors. By providing a direct visual assessment and the ability to perform therapeutic interventions, this procedure offers significant advantages over other diagnostic methods.
Studies have shown that Deep Small Intestine Endoscopy can detect over 90% of small bowel tumors. The procedure’s effectiveness can be influenced by several factors. For example, the effectiveness is higher when the endoscopist has significant experience with the procedure and when high-quality equipment is used.
On the other hand, factors such as extensive small bowel disease, previous abdominal surgery causing adhesions, or poor bowel preparation may lower the procedure’s effectiveness.
It’s also important to understand that while Deep Small Intestine Endoscopy is highly effective, it’s not always definitive. Sometimes, additional tests or procedures may be required. Adverse Events with Deep Small Intestine Endoscopy
Like all medical procedures, Deep Small Intestine Endoscopy carries some risks, though they are generally low. The most common adverse events include:
- Bleeding (2-3%): This could occur if a biopsy is taken or a polyp is removed. The blood loss is usually minimal and rarely requires transfusions or other interventions.
- Pancreatitis (1-2%): This is an inflammation of the pancreas that could occur if the procedure unintentionally irritates the pancreas.
- Perforation (less than 1%): This is a small hole in the wall of the small intestine that could require surgery to repair.
- Infection (less than 1%): While rare, infections can occur, especially if a biopsy is taken or if there is a perforation.
The mortality rate from Deep Small Intestine Endoscopy is extremely low, less than 0.1%.
Alternatives to Deep Small Intestine Endoscopy
While Deep Small Intestine Endoscopy is an effective procedure for diagnosing and treating small bowel tumors, it’s not the only option. Other diagnostic procedures include CT or MRI enterography, capsule endoscopy, and double-balloon endoscopy. Depending on the size and location of the tumor, surgical interventions or chemotherapy may also be considered. Lifestyle modifications, such as changes in diet, can aid in overall digestive health but are not specific treatments for small bowel tumors.
